On Wed, May 08, 2024 at 12:31:14PM +0200, Marek Behún wrote:
> Add support for the watchdog mechanism provided by the MCU.
...
> + return omnia_cmd_write_u16(mcu->client, OMNIA_CMD_SET_WDT_TIMEOUT,
> + timeout * 10);
DECI (from units.h)
...
> + return timeleft / 10;
Ditto.
...
> + mcu->wdt.max_timeout = 6553; /* 65535 deciseconds */
Ditto.
mcu->wdt.max_timeout = 65536 / DECI;
(and no need in a comment)
